Yuma's insurance market is competitive and geographically distinct โ agencies here serve a mix of military families from MCAS Yuma, snowbirds, agricultural businesses, and year-round residents with specific desert-climate coverage needs. If your book of business has plateaued, the culprit is often a handful of fixable marketing mistakes rather than a lack of hustle.
Treating Yuma Like Every Other Arizona Market
Generic marketing campaigns designed for Phoenix or Tucson rarely land in Yuma. The city has its own rhythm: snowbird season runs roughly October through April, agricultural operations dominate the surrounding county, and the extreme summer heat (regularly topping 115ยฐF) shapes real concerns around property coverage, vehicle policies, and business interruption.
What to do instead:
- Build seasonal messaging around snowbird arrivals and departures โ these temporary residents often need short-term auto policies, renters coverage, or Medicare supplement reviews
- Speak directly to farm and agribusiness owners about crop insurance, equipment coverage, and liability during harvest season
- Highlight heat-specific coverages like HVAC breakdown endorsements or policies that address monsoon roof and water damage claims
If your ad copy could run unchanged in Flagstaff, it's not doing enough work for you in Yuma.
Ignoring Google Business Profile (or Setting It and Forgetting It)
A surprising number of local agencies either have an unclaimed Google Business Profile or haven't updated it since they opened. In a city the size of Yuma, a well-optimized profile is one of your highest-ROI marketing assets.
- Add photos of your actual office (interior, exterior, staff)
- List all lines of business you write โ don't make potential clients guess
- Collect and respond to every review, positive or negative
- Post seasonal updates ("Open during the holidays," "Now helping snowbirds review Medicare plans")
Potential clients searching "insurance agency near me" in Yuma see Google profiles before they see your website. If your profile looks dormant, they'll click your competitor.
Underestimating Referral Network Development
Word-of-mouth is still the dominant acquisition channel for independent agencies, yet many Yuma brokers treat referral-building as passive luck rather than an active strategy. The city's relatively small professional community actually makes this easier than it sounds.
Strong referral partners for Yuma insurance agencies include:
- Real estate agents (especially those working the active winter-visitor market)
- Mortgage lenders and title companies
- Auto dealerships near the I-8 corridor
- CPA firms that serve agricultural and small business clients
- Local HR consultants and benefits advisors
Schedule a brief quarterly coffee or lunch with your top referral sources. Track where your leads are actually coming from โ most agency owners are surprised by the data when they first pull it.

Skipping Content That Addresses Real Local Questions
A common shortcut is publishing generic insurance blog posts ("5 Reasons You Need Life Insurance") that provide no local context. Yuma residents and business owners have specific questions โ and answering them builds trust and search traffic simultaneously.
| Generic Topic | Yuma-Specific Angle |
|---|---|
| Homeowners insurance basics | Coverage gaps related to monsoon roof damage |
| Auto insurance tips | High-heat tire blowout and breakdown scenarios |
| Business insurance overview | Agribusiness and farm equipment policies in Yuma County |
| Medicare supplement info | Guides timed to snowbird season arrivals |
Even two to four locally relevant posts per year outperform a dozen recycled national pieces.
Poor Follow-Up Processes for Quotes and Leads
An agency can generate solid leads and still stall on growth if follow-up is inconsistent. Insurance shoppers in Yuma โ like everywhere โ are comparing multiple agencies simultaneously. Research consistently shows that first-response time is one of the strongest predictors of conversion.
Practical fixes:
- Set an internal standard: respond to every web or phone inquiry within one business hour during office hours
- Use a simple CRM (even a spreadsheet beats nothing) to track where each prospect is in the pipeline
- Send a brief follow-up email or text 24-48 hours after a quote if you haven't heard back
- Build a 30-day drip sequence for prospects who didn't convert โ circumstances change

Overlooking the Value of a Professional, Consistent Brand
In a relationship-driven business like insurance, first impressions matter. Inconsistent logos across platforms, an outdated website that isn't mobile-responsive, or a Facebook page with posts from three years ago all send quiet signals that undermine trust before a conversation even starts.
You don't need a full agency rebrand โ often a refreshed headshot, consistent color scheme, and a policy of posting at least twice a month is enough to look credibly active.
Growth for Yuma insurance agencies rarely requires a massive budget โ it requires doing the fundamentals well, consistently, and with a genuine understanding of who your local market actually is.
